出 处:《武汉工程大学学报》1993年第1期8-13,共6页Journal of Wuhan Institute of Technology
摘 要:哈里蒙德管浮选试验表明,双膦酸W-10对胶磷矿强烈抑制而对白云石抑制很弱,表现出良好的选择性。混合矿的分选表明在pH为6时获得相同的分选效率,双膦酸的浓度只需磷酸的1/200。即使在中性及碱性介质中,也有很好的分选效果。由双膦酸的逐级解离常数可知,在pH为5~7时,它能与Ca^(2+)以六元环螯合而使磷矿物受强烈抑制。在pH为9时,作用的机制与磷酸在pH为6时相似。Hallimond tube flotation shows that diphosphonic acid W -10 depresses phosphate strongly, bat has almost no effect on dolomite. The mixtion of phosphate and dolomite indicates that to obtain same separation efficiency at pH 6, only 1 / 200 concentration of phosphoric acid is required for W-10 used as depressant, It also works well even in neutral and alkaline mediums. It may be know from dissociation constants of W-10 that W-10 can chelate Ca2+ to form a hexabasic ring at pH 5~ 7 however, its mechanism of depression at pH 9 is similar to that of phosphoric acid at pH 6,
